Basic Information
| Brand Name |
Citi |
| Identity |
The largest financial institution in the world originated from the merger between Citicorp and Travelers Group in 1998. |
Important Dates
- 1812 City Bank of New York is established
- 1962 named The First National Bank of New York.
- 1977 renamed to Citibank, member of the Citicorp group.
- 1998 Citicorp and Travelers Group merge into Citigroup Inc.
- February 2007 - Citigroup announces unified Global Brand Identity under "Citi" name and its recognizable red arc design, while Citigroup Inc. is preserved as the legal entity.
Citi today
Citi today:
- Includes under the trademark red arc the major brand names of Citibank, CitiFinancial, Primerica, Citi Smith Barney and Banamex.
- Performs business in more than 100 countries.
- Has more than 200 million customer accounts all over the world.
- Employs more than 350,000 employees all over the world.
Citi in Greece
The group under the legal entity Citibank International plc. is active in the following fields: Citi Markets & Banking, Citibank Consumer Bank and Citi Private Bank.
